Abstract
High-performance liquid chromatography coupled with mass spectrometry detection was used to separate and characterize some dinuclear iron de rivatives of general formula [Fe2(CO)5(Ph2PXEPh2-p){Et2C2(CO)C2Et2)] ( X = CH2 or CH2CH2, E = P or As). Reversed-phase conditions and a parti cle-beam (PB) interface were used. The chromatographic behaviour of th ese compounds depends strongly on the substituents in the ligands. The fragmentation pathways both in electron impact and in chemical ioniza tion mode mass spectrometry were studied.
